POSITION SUMMARY

The dental assistant’s primary responsibility is to assist the dentist with clinical procedures. This includes chair side assisting, x-rays, taking alginate impressions, and screening emergency patients. The assistant will be expected to assist in four-handed dental procedures including, but not limited to: initial exams, periodontal maintenance, amalgam and composite restorations, endodontics, oral surgery, crown and bridge, and removable prosthodontics. By the end of the assistant’s training period he or she will be expected to be proficient in all procedures routinely performed in the clinic.

PRIMARY TASKS AND DUTIES

Room Preparation and Turnover

Prepare room set up for standard and specialty procedures

Prepare hand pieces for laboratory and operatory use

Prepare for medical emergencies

Disinfect operatory according to company standards

Assist in sterilization areas as necessary

Maintain operatory equipment according to manufacturer guidelines

Dispose of waste and hazardous materials in compliance with OSHA/EPA/FDA/NIOSH regulations

Direct Patient Care

Welcome and dismiss patient in a professional and courteous manner

Take digital x-rays (Pan, BWX’s, PAs)

Obtain, interpret, and evaluate personal, medical and dental histories

Take and record patient vitals

Demonstrate four-handed instrument transfer

Prepare and assist with administration of topical and local anesthesia

Prepare mounting and articulation of study models for impressions

Fabricate temporaries for crowns and bridges

Pour and trim cast/model

Prepare and assist with restorative treatment

Prepare and assist with varnish and fluoride applications

Prepare and assist with minor, oral surgery and endodontic therapy procedures

Prepare and assist with alginate impression

Chart oral condition as dictated by dentist

Post-op Patient Education

Explain postoperative and preoperative instructions to the patient

Schedule follow up appointment

Electronic Health Record (EHR) Utilization

Properly label and input tooth/teeth numbers into patient electronic chart

Review doctors schedule prior to patient visit for scheduling errors and lab case preparation
